iOSCPSEO: Mastering App Store Optimization for Apple Enthusiasts
Let's kick things off with iOSCPSEO, which, as you might have guessed, revolves around optimizing apps for the Apple App Store. Now, app store optimization (ASO) is crucial if you're an app developer wanting to get your creation noticed amidst the millions of apps vying for attention. Think of it as SEO, but specifically for the App Store. The better your ASO, the higher your app ranks in search results, leading to more visibility, downloads, and ultimately, success. So, how do you master iOSCPSEO? Several key factors come into play.
First up, keyword research is paramount. You need to understand what terms users are searching for when looking for apps like yours. Tools like Sensor Tower, App Annie, and even the App Store's own search suggestions can provide valuable insights. Once you've identified relevant keywords, strategically incorporate them into your app's title, subtitle, and keyword fields. But don't just stuff keywords in there haphazardly! Make sure they read naturally and accurately reflect your app's functionality.
Next, optimize your app's description. This is your chance to really sell your app to potential users. Highlight its key features, benefits, and what makes it unique. Use clear, concise language and avoid technical jargon that might confuse people. Also, consider adding a compelling call to action to encourage downloads. Visuals are also super important! High-quality screenshots and a captivating app preview video can significantly increase conversion rates. Showcase your app's best features and demonstrate how it solves users' problems. Finally, pay attention to ratings and reviews. Positive reviews build trust and credibility, while negative reviews can deter potential users. Encourage satisfied users to leave reviews and promptly address any negative feedback to show that you care about their experience.

SCBlues: Exploring the World of Southern California Blues Music
Alright, shifting gears completely, let's dive into the soulful sounds of SCBlues, or Southern California Blues music. For those of you who don't know, the blues is a genre of music that originated in the African American communities of the Deep South in the United States around the end of the 19th century. It's characterized by its melancholic melodies, heartfelt lyrics, and distinctive instrumentation, typically featuring guitars, harmonicas, and vocals filled with emotion. Southern California has a rich blues history, with numerous talented musicians and vibrant venues that have shaped the genre's evolution.
The SCBlues scene is a melting pot of different styles and influences. You'll find everything from traditional Delta blues to electric Chicago blues to contemporary blues-rock. Many talented artists call Southern California home, including legendary figures and up-and-coming performers. These musicians often perform at local clubs, bars, and festivals, creating a thriving community for blues lovers. Some notable venues for SCBlues include the House of Blues in Anaheim, The Mint in Los Angeles, and various smaller clubs and bars throughout the region. These venues provide a platform for both established and emerging artists to showcase their talent and connect with audiences.

Jays Pitchers: Analyzing the Toronto Blue Jays' Pitching Staff
Finally, let's talk baseball! Specifically, the Jays pitchers, or the Toronto Blue Jays' pitching staff. For any baseball enthusiast, the pitching staff is the backbone of a team. A strong pitching rotation and a reliable bullpen can make all the difference between a playoff contender and a bottom-dweller. The Blue Jays have had their share of ups and downs when it comes to pitching, but they're always striving to build a staff that can compete with the best in the league. A starting rotation typically consists of five pitchers who take turns starting each game. These pitchers are expected to pitch deep into games, providing quality innings and keeping the team in contention. Key metrics for evaluating starting pitchers include earned run average (ERA), strikeouts, walks, and innings pitched.
The Blue Jays' bullpen is a group of relief pitchers who come in to pitch after the starting pitcher has been removed from the game. Relief pitchers are often specialized in certain roles, such as closing out games or pitching in high-leverage situations. A strong bullpen can be crucial for preserving leads and winning close games. Key metrics for evaluating relief pitchers include ERA, strikeouts, walks, and saves. Analyzing the performance of the Jays pitchers involves looking at both individual statistics and overall team performance. Factors such as injuries, age, and contract status can also influence the composition and effectiveness of the pitching staff.
